3.Locate the Clear CMOS/Recovery jumper on the system board. See “Identifying parts on the system board” a pagina 7.

4.Move the jumper from the standard position (pins 1 and 2) to the maintenance or configure position (pins 2 and 3).

5.Replace the computer cover and connect the power cord. See Figura 39 a pagina 31.

6.Restart the computer, leave it on for approximately ten seconds. Turn off the computer by holding the power switch for approximately five seconds. The computer will turn off.

7.Repeat steps 1 through 3 on page 34.

8.Move the Clear CMOS/Recovery jumper back to the standard position (pins 1 and 2).

9.Replace the computer cover and connect the power cord. See Capitolo 4, “Completing the parts replacement”, a pagina 31.
